Prior to Marist: Fox's high school team were named Mission Trail Athletic League Champions from 2015-2017, Central Coast Selection Champions from 2016-2017 and made it to the Northern California Semi Finals her Junior and Senior year. In 2017 she was named to the mission trail athletic league first team, first team all-county, Max Preps California All-State Volleyball Team and Max Preps Small School All-American girls Volleyball first team. Sister Taylor played basketball at Colorado State University at Pueblo.
